Gunnar Berndtson, full name, Gunnar Fredrik Berndtson (1854 – 1895)
Gunnar Berndtson was a Finnish painter, who was noted for his attention to realistic detail. In 1876, Berndtson went to Paris and enrolled at the École des Beaux-Arts, where he studied under Jean-Léon Gérôme, whilst there, he became interested in the Salon style of painting. From 1822 to 1823 he was in Egypt where he joined the French community there, painting portraits and producing illustrations for the French publication, Le Monde Illustré. In 1886 he returned to Finland but made frequent trips back to Paris, to exhibit his work at the Salon.
